Winemakers Notes
Aromas of ripe dark fruits—black plum and jammy black cherry—merge with notes of spice, herbs and subtle oak.
The wine is at once fleshy, focused and firm. Fresh black fruit flavors overlay fine-grained tannins, and the long, smooth finish ends with a hint of tarragon. Deliciously approachable and richly satisfying.

Vintage Notes
The 2007 vintage was an excellent one for Pinot Noir. Responding to a cold, dry winter and scant spring rains (rainfall in northern California was 40%–50% lower than average in 2007), vine vigor was minimized from the outset and the vines didn’t produce too much foliage. Spring temperatures were warm, and the growing season started out fast with early bloom and fruit set. Then the weather cooled and mild temperatures prevailed throughout summer and into August. Enjoying ideal conditions of sunny days and foggy evenings, the grapes ripened slowly and evenly. We began picking fruit for this Pinot Noir on September 6 and finished September 11. Because of the cold, dry winter, 2007 crop levels were slightly lower than usual, but thanks to the mild summer weather, quality was consistently excellent. Grapes: (average) 26.4º Brix with 0.70% initial acid and 3.35 pH
Tasting Notes
Ruby red in color, this wine has aromas and flavors of wild plum, black cherry and blueberries. Layers of sweet fruit mingle with a savory spiciness on the mid-palate and a hint of minerality for additional complexity. Beautifully balanced with fresh, velvety tannins, the wine culminates with a persistent finish. A Pinot Noir with great verve and vivacity—ripe, concentrated and seamlessly mouthfilling.
